## Build Provenance: Monthly Partitioning

The Veldrin build service stores provenance records in tables partitioned by calendar month (UTC). Plugin authors querying attestation history must include the month key in every lookup; cross-partition scans are rejected. Partitions older than eighteen months roll to cold storage, and retrieval requires a manifest request. When reporting a provenance mismatch, always attach the token below.

pipeline stamp: htk21_4adfc7a400dc735eb9849

Runbook fragment — Quillbase query planner regression. If p95 latency on analytical reads exceeds the agreed threshold after the 4.2 rollout, disable the new join-reordering pass before anything else, then capture plans for the three canary queries and attach them to the incident channel. To roll the planner back safely, restart the coordinator with the following configuration values.

config for kafof-bawef:
holath:
  log_level: debug
  metrics_host: metrics.holath.qorvelsys.internal
  pin: 2191
  pool_size: 32

## Deployment notes: stale-cache postmortem follow-up

After the Quillmark incident where edge nodes served week-old plugin manifests, we shortened cache TTLs and added mandatory revalidation on deploy. Plugin authors should assume manifests propagate within five minutes, not instantly, and should version assets accordingly. These safeguards are enforced server-side and cannot be disabled per plugin. The deployment environment now ships with the following values baked in.

deployment values, taweg-bajop:
[fenvan]
port = 5672
team = holmir
host = fenvan.orvexio.example
region = lower-1
access_code = ac_b98bc6
timeout_ms = 1500